Abstract
Un método para mejorar la separación de emulsiones micelares de petróleo-agua. tales como aquellas que se encuentren en los fluidos de producción. Específicamente, una realización de la presente consiste en separar fases de petróleo y de agua en fluido de producción recuperado, agregando una sal iónica, tal como cloruro de sodio, cloruro de calcio, carbonato de sodio, bicarbonato de sodio, y/o un alcohol con alto peso molecular, tal como 2-etil hexanol o decanol, al fluido de producción.
